Annual inspections will get the job done very well in keeping infestations at bay, and since were going to tell you just how to find these pests, its something that you can do on your own.

Termites can invade the exterior of the house quickly. There are a couple of areas that youll need to inspect to ensure that there isnt a presence of termites. A Couple of things to test are:

Wood-to-Ground Contacts: Any wood from the home or yard that comes in contact with dirt are great areas to check. All along your fence should be examined as well as any porches.

Firewood: The smell and heat of firewood is unmatched, but if its close to your residence, its going to be a problem. Set the wood 20 30 feet from the house. Termites will nest in the wood, and if its too close to the house, they might also opt to eat away at your homes timber. .

Mulch: Wood mulch is often found in gardens and around trees. This may offer an aesthetic upgrade to your garden, but it will also be a significant point of nesting to your termite friends. Replacing mulch with stones or anythingbut mulch is a good idea.

And while your exterior, youll also want to check for any standing water which might or might not exist. Check the gutters for any standing water, and also have them cleared if you do find water in them.

If you do find water accumulating, youll want to remedy the matter. Moisture or any kinds of water is going to be a prime place for subterranean termites to burrow into the ground and form a colony. The mud tunnels can lead right into the crawlspace of the home, where termites will nourish and escape while going undetected. .

Baseboards: Assess all along the baseboard in the home. This will be an entire examination of those homes perimeter to look for any pipes or tiny pieces of dirt which look like theyre from place.

Under the Sinks: Moist places, like under the sink and in the laundry area, ought to be examined. Look for small tubes or holes as well as tiny specks of dirt around any and all connecting pipes.

Crawlspaces: A prime spot for termites. Youll want to look for any mud tubes or even termites in your crawlspaces. Be certain to bring a flashlight along with you on this excursion.

If you think youve found an area of timber which might have been infested with termites, then youll want to grab the screwdriver and poke the timber. If the screwdriver goes into the Look At This wood easily, this is a common sign of an infestation.

Should you hear a sound that sounds just like the timber is hollow, this is a great indication that termites could have eaten through the inside of the wood.

Another good indicator of a swarm is finding wings. These pests will drop their wings when theyre done mating. Wings are often found on baseboards or window sills. There are advanced ways to test and find termites. What many people dont know is that the wood they consume is eaten from the inside out. This means you may see a beam which looks perfectly sound and secure, but the inner area of the beam may have been eaten off, with an army of termites still inside causing their hidden, damaging damage. .
